About the role
Toora Women is a not-for-profit organisation which has been delivering gender specific services to women in the ACT and surrounds since 1982. Our purpose is to be the leading organisation in the ACT providing safe, respectful support for all women who are impacted by domestic and family violence, homelessness, the criminal justice system and/or alcohol and drug dependency and a provider of choice for First nations women and children.
We are seeking an experienced and passionate Bullandyimma Yurwangdyimma Program Senior Practitioner (Many Strong Women) to provide cultural leadership, practice guidance and direct support that strengthens outcomes for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ander women, children and families engaging with Toora.
This role combines strategic leadership, cultural advocacy, stakeholder engagement and direct service delivery. Working across the organisation, you will support the development of culturally safe, trauma informed and self determined approaches while strengthening relationships with Aboriginal communities and Aboriginal Community Controlled Organisations.
